Output 00c58652b6401e43df2c6d22291423f1a3fc72ffa2d659dc1528aecbbc1e7486:1

value
1786214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6b7bee29424f9af8e32d4335ff800ad2c999286 OP_EQUAL
address
3GtYDFxwFLqtyQd9zuPF6rPBGSAQuxixWN
transaction
00c58652b6401e43df2c6d22291423f1a3fc72ffa2d659dc1528aecbbc1e7486
confirmations
328000
spent
true